Output 6cfbf76c600f370a52597f0947e2c28c32f5f68da2904023182a8e977dfce37d:0

value
41300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cdafed4eb96ed66973e9a178ae22d30ad6f8bb3 OP_EQUAL
address
3JubJgFXkRoRtwjkpf2FMz4z7kEWypKEqf
transaction
6cfbf76c600f370a52597f0947e2c28c32f5f68da2904023182a8e977dfce37d
spent
true